Meeting: 21/08/2025 - Planning Development Management Committee (Item 6)
6 Aberdeen Planning Guidance: Health Impact Assessments - CR&E/25/200

Decision:
The Committee resolved:-
(i) to approve the Aberdeen Planning Guidance: Health Impact Assessment (Appendix 1) as non-statutory planning advice;
(ii) to note the findings of the consultation on the Draft Health Impact Assessment Guidance Document, and subsequent responses and revisions proposed by Officers to the Draft document (Appendix 2);
(iii) to instruct the Chief Officer - Strategic Place Planning to review Section 75 agreements during the production of the Aberdeen Local Development Plan 2028, in order to assess how a 'health in all policies' approach can be more effectively integrated with future developer obligations;
(iv) to instruct the Chief Officer - Strategic Place Planning to review the appendices of the Aberdeen Planning Guidance: Health Impact Assessment on an annual basis to ensure the data remains up to date, and to publish any updates on the Council’s website; and
(v) to request that a report be brought back to this Committee in one year, to provide details on how the guidance has been implemented.
Minutes:
With reference to article 7 of the minute of the meeting of 20 June 2024, the Committee had before it a report by the Chief Officer – Strategic Place Planning, which sought approval to adopt the Aberdeen Planning Guidance (APG): Health Impact Assessments.
The report recommended:-
that the Committee –
(a) approve the Aberdeen Planning Guidance: Health Impact Assessment (Appendix 1) as non-statutory planning advice;
(b) note the findings of the consultation on the Draft Health Impact Assessment Guidance Document, and subsequent responses and revisions proposed by Officers to the Draft document (Appendix 2);
(c) instruct the Chief Officer - Strategic Place Planning to review Section 75 agreements during the production of the Aberdeen Local Development Plan 2028, in order to assess how a 'health in all policies' approach can be more effectively integrated with future developer obligations; and
(d) instruct the Chief Officer - Strategic Place Planning to review the appendices of the Aberdeen Planning Guidance: Health Impact Assessment on an annual basis to ensure the data remains up to date, and to publish any updates on the Council’s website.
The Committee resolved:
(i) to request that a report be brought back to this Committee in one year, to provide details on how the guidance has been implemented; and
(ii) to approve the recommendations
